Mutsu, located in Aomori Prefecture, Japan, is a city that captivates with its vast natural landscapes and deep cultural roots. As the largest municipality in the prefecture by area, Mutsu provides a peaceful retreat for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le of city life. Visitors can enjoy hiking through its scenic terrains, exploring local traditions, and immersing themselves in the unique cultural tapestry that defines this region. Whether you're a nature enthusiast or a cultural explorer, Mutsu offers a tranquil yet enriching experience.

April-June, September-November
Spring is mild and perfect for exploring the natural landscapes and enjoying cherry blossoms.
Summer offers warm weather ideal for outdoor activities but can be busy with tourists.
Fall provides a beautiful backdrop of changing leaves, perfect for hiking and photography.
Winters are cold but offer a unique opportunity to experience local festivals and hot springs.
